Battle in the Bay in the Books

Sep 26, 2022

SAN FRANCISCO – As the academic year begins on campus, the fall tennis season began over the weekend at The California Tennis Club. Four student-athletes participated at the Battle in the Bay, which featured teams from around the country and many players ranked in the preseason ITA poll.

Aryan Chaudhary and Filip Kolasinski earned placements in the main draw in singles, going 1-1 and 0-2, respectively. Chaudhary knocked off the nation's No. 120 player in Portland's Sema Pankin in the opening round before falling to No. 45 Tim Zeitvogel (Pepperdine) in the round of 16. Kolasinski battled two opponents to tight finishes, but fell in two sets to both opponents.

Neel Rajesh and Isaac Gorelik competed in the qualifying round, with Rajesh going 3-1 in singles to lead the way. Returning to the program after a year away, Rajesh advanced to the semifinal round in the qualifying bracket, besting two opponents from UNLV and one from UC Santa Cruz. Gorelik, a transfer from Tufts, picked up his first two wins at Stanford, while the doubles tandem of Rajesh and Gorelik went 1-1.

The Cardinal heads to Tulsa, Oklahoma for the second tournament of the fall, the ITA All-American Championships. The event begins Oct. 1 and runs through Oct. 9.
